Mourinho on the verge of agreeing deal with Fenerbahce

Jose Mourinho's time away from the football world will be short-lived. After leaving his position as coach of Roma in January, the renowned Portuguese manager has wasted no time in finding a new opportunity.

According to Italian transfer expert Fabrizio Romano, Mourinho is expected to take charge of Fenerbahce in Turkey for the upcoming season. It is reported that he has agreed to a two-year contract with the Istanbul-based club, with the possibility of extending for another season.

The negotiations between Mourinho and Fenerbahce were facilitated by the well-known agent Jorge Mendes. Now, all that remains is the signing of the necessary paperwork to finalize the deal.

If the move goes through, Fenerbahce will become Mourinho's tenth club as a manager. Throughout his career, he has coached teams such as Benfica, Leiria, Porto, Chelsea, Inter, Real Madrid, Manchester United, Tottenham, and Roma.

Interestingly, Mourinho may reunite with former player Edin Dzeko, whom he briefly managed during his time at Roma. Additionally, Fenerbahce boasts other notable players like Brazilian Fred, whom Mourinho worked with at Manchester United, as well as Dusan Tadic and Michy Batshuayi.

Last season, Fenerbahce was led by Turkish coach Ismail Kartal, and under his guidance, the team only suffered one defeat in the league, accumulating an impressive 99 points. However, their efforts fell short as Galatasaray clinched the title with a remarkable 102 points. Fenerbahce's quest for their 20th Turkish championship has now extended to a decade.
